Nails have signed a record deal with Closed Casket Activities and released "Fear Based Life", a two-song preview of their fifth full-length, which is due in summer 2027. The songs are streaming now; a vinyl edition arrives on 9 October through the label.
According to the band, the signing formalises an arrangement that has existed informally since 2011, when they began consulting Justin Louden of Closed Casket Activities on touring and business decisions. "There hasn't been a more instrumental asset to Nails than Closed Casket Activities in the past 15 years," the statement reads, adding that the band has "never had a bad label".
For a band of Nails' size, fifteen years of unpaid advisory work turning into a contract is the industry's version of a long engagement: the label has already done the job, and the deal mostly changes who is named on the back of the record.
The two tracks were written in November and December 2025, recorded by Andrew Solis and mastered by Nick Townsend. Cover art is by Jef Whitehead (Wrest), with inner artwork by Cavan Hoover, photography by Duran Levinson in Berlin, and layout by Martin Stuart.
